In a certain charge distribution, all points having zero potential can be joined by a circle S. Points inside S have positive potential, and points outside S have a negative potential. A positive charge, which is free to move, is placed inside S .

You've reached today's free limit of 20 questions. Log in to keep practising for free.
Explanation

A free positive charge move from higher (positive) potential to lower (negative) potential. Hence, it must cross S at some time.

Two thin wire rings each having a radius R are placed at a distance d apart with their axes coinciding. The charges on the two rings are +q and –q. The potential difference between the centres of the two rings is -

You've reached today's free limit of 20 questions. Log in to keep practising for free.
Explanation

The potential difference between the centers of two thin wire rings of radius R, placed at a distance d apart with charges +q and -q, is given by (q/2πε₀)[1/R - 1/√(R² + d²)]. This is obtained by considering the potential due to each ring at the center of the other ring and taking their difference.
